OOH will go through numerous changes in UP: Y Srinivas Raju

By Satarupa Chakraborty - October 14, 2015

Growing population, purchasing power and expanding economy have made UP a palatable state for investment. More investment will attract more OOH need, thus requiring more boost in UP market's outdoor industry.

Calling himself an avid explorer and marking his first visit to Lucknow, Y Srinivas Raju, VP - Planning & Insights, Milestone Brandcom presented a statistical overview of the OOH industry's current status & growth in UP. Presenting his topic at UP Talks OOH 2015 in Lucknow, Srinivas touched the points like UP being the largest state with a sizeable population of 19.9 crores, Srinivas expressed his visualization of the state as changing gear of India in politics (85 percent MPs are from the state) and economy. Following some interesting facts like UP, if separated as a country, can fit as 5th largest country after Ireland, Australia, Finland and China and the fact that UP's population is growing steadily at 4 percent which will lead to 44 crores in 2050, Srinivas reported the state to have biggest opportunity that no investor can negate. According to him, out of 71 districts of the state, 62 towns are cosmopolitan while having a growing purchasing power along with population resulting into a collective curiousness looking at upgrade. There are cosmopolitan cities like Lucknow, Kanpur, Agra, Bareilly while tier-I and Tier-II cities like Muzaffarnagar and Agra are catching up.

  • Why OOH is important in UP:
  • Core Hindi speaking markets (best and must for media and entertainment industry), where UP's contribution is equivalent to Mumbai i.e 9%)
  • Cost Vs Viewership makes it a critical market.
  • High telecom penetration (1.96 cr telecom users already)
  • Rise of FMCG in small towns
  • Increased purchasing power towards automobiles
  • Boom in real estate, with 12 smart cities already proposed in UP
  • Start of Metro rail operation by 2017
  • Proposal of 7 new airports
  • State with most young population - consumer leaders and women empowerment.

"Despite the fact that UP has been witnessing fast growth, OOH market of the state has not grown at that pace. Also, OOH is the second most reachable media in UP. In coming years, it's going to go through numerous changes. Let us leverage on the pull factors and upgradation of the state,” Srinivas concluded.
